Advanced Technology Drives Farm Equipment Manufacturing Forward

The agricultural industry has witnessed a significant transformation in recent years, driven by the adoption of advanced technology in farm equipment manufacturing. The integration of artificial intelligence, internet of things (IoT), and data analytics has enabled the development of more efficient, productive, and sustainable farming practices. As a result, farm equipment manufacturers have been able to design and produce more sophisticated and connected machines that can optimize crop yields, reduce waste, and minimize environmental impact.

Farm Equipment

The use of precision agriculture techniques, such as GPS guidance and autonomous navigation, has become increasingly prevalent in modern farming. These technologies enable farmers to precisely control the movement of their equipment, reducing overlap and skips, and optimizing the application of seeds, fertilizers, and pesticides. Additionally, the implementation of telematics and remote monitoring systems allows farmers to track the performance of their equipment in real-time, enabling predictive maintenance and minimizing downtime.

The incorporation of electric and hybrid propulsion systems in farm equipment is also gaining traction, offering a more environmentally friendly and cost-effective alternative to traditional fossil fuel-based powertrains. Furthermore, the development of autonomous farming systems is expected to revolutionize the industry, enabling farmers to automate many tasks and focus on higher-value activities such as crop management and data analysis.

Green Revolution Through Eco Friendly Farming Methods

The Green Revolution has been a significant movement in the agricultural sector, aiming to increase food production and reduce hunger worldwide. However, the traditional methods used in this revolution have had negative impacts on the environment, such as soil degradation, water pollution, and biodiversity loss. To address these issues, eco-friendly farming methods have been introduced, which prioritize sustainability and environmental conservation.

Some of the key eco-friendly farming methods include organic farming, permaculture, and regenerative agriculture. These methods focus on using natural resources, minimizing waste, and promoting biodiversity. They also encourage the use of renewable energy sources, such as solar and wind power, to reduce dependence on fossil fuels. By adopting these methods, farmers can reduce their environmental footprint and contribute to a more sustainable food system.

Benefits of eco-friendly farming methods include improved soil health, increased crop yields, and enhanced ecosystem services. These methods also promote climate change mitigation by reducing greenhouse gas emissions and sequestering carbon in soils. Furthermore, eco-friendly farming methods can help to preserve water resources and reduce the use of synthetic fertilizers and pesticides, which can harm human health and the environment.

Global Agricultural Trade Policy Reforms Underway

The global agricultural trade policy landscape is undergoing significant reforms, driven by the need to improve food security, reduce trade barriers, and promote sustainable agriculture. The World Trade Organization (WTO) is at the forefront of these efforts, working to establish a fair and equitable global trading system. One of the key areas of focus is the Doha Development Agenda, which aims to reduce tariffs and other trade distortions that hinder the growth of agricultural trade.

Another important initiative is the Agricultural Market Information System (AMIS), which provides market analysis and price forecasting to help farmers and traders make informed decisions. The AMIS also facilitates international cooperation and information sharing to address food price volatility and promote stable markets.

In addition to these global initiatives, regional trade agreements are also being established to promote agricultural trade and economic integration. For example, the Trans-Pacific Partnership (TPP) and the European Union's Common Agricultural Policy (CAP) aim to reduce trade barriers and promote sustainable agriculture practices. These reforms have the potential to increase food availability, improve nutrition, and reduce poverty in rural communities.

Overall, the global agricultural trade policy reforms underway have the potential to transform the agricultural sector and promote sustainable development.
